Subject: DR drill — catalogue import

Team,

Tomorrow's drill restores the Larkspool library catalogue from the nightly export and replays the import into the standby cluster. Expect roughly 40 minutes of elevated load. If the import worker stalls, restart it from the warm snapshot, not from scratch. To unlock the standby restore vault, use the passphrase below.

unlock words, hahip-baduf: holwyn-istath-julvan

## v4.12.0 — Ledgerwick Payments Core

- Added idempotency keys to all payment retry paths. Duplicate charge attempts within a 24-hour window now return the original transaction result instead of re-executing.
- Keys persist in the retry ledger for 30 days.
- Migration runs automatically on deploy; no manual steps.
- Rollback safe: legacy retries without keys remain accepted until v4.14.

For release sign-off, the responsible engineer is listed below.

account owner for bawip-tahag: Raleth Quenok

## Action item: pin cron drift thresholds

Follow-up from the Thornquist scheduler incident — the nightly jobs on the Driftmere boxes were sliding by a few minutes per week because NTP sync and the cron daemon disagreed about the wall clock. We're adding an explicit drift monitor so this gets caught before reports go stale again. Owner: scheduling squad, due next sprint. Monitor thresholds are set as follows.

tuning constants:
QUOTAS = {
    "druwyn": 5,
    "holix": 5,
    "zorath": 5,
    "holwyn": 10,
}